TAMPA, Fla., Jan. 26, 2021 /PRNewswire/ — Lazydays, The RV Authority®, announces that it will open a second Minnesota dealership in Monticello, Minnesota.  Concurrent with its decision to open the new dealership, Lazydays has signed a Real Estate Purchase Agreement for a 10.68 acre property with approximately 57,000 sq. ft. of indoor dealership space adjacent to Interstate 94 in Monticello, Minnesota.  Lazydays plans to commence operations in Spring 2021.

«We are very excited to expand in Minnesota,» stated William P. Murnane, Lazydays Chairman and CEO.  «Minnesota is a top 10 RV state and this will be our second sales center in Minnesota. The new dealership is ideally located northwest of Minneapolis between Minneapolis and St. Cloud, and will offer leading brands including Tiffin, Coachmen, Thor, Forest River, Vanleigh and Winnebago. In addition, the large indoor showroom at this dealership will offer customers a warm and welcoming environment to shop for an RV during the cold Minnesota winters. Our current sales center in Ramsey will be converted to a stand alone Airstream dealership with dedicated sales and service teams,» commented Murnane.   

Lazydays currently operates eleven dealerships in Florida (2), Colorado (2), Arizona (2), Minnesota (1), Tennessee (2), and Indiana (2); and operates a dedicated Service Center location near Houston, Texas.  In addition to a second Minnesota location, Lazydays recently announced its intent to acquire Sprad’s RV in Reno, Nevada.

SHANGHAI, Jan. 26, 2021 /PRNewswire/ — In the last 9 months, Gerber has experienced tremendous revenue growth in China driven by its digital transformation and innovation initiatives to help brands, retailers and manufacturers get the efficiency, productivity, quality and ROI they need to stay competitive. Over the last several months, Gerber has set forth an aggressive plan to digitize the fashion, furniture, automotive and technical textile industries by introducing new innovations to the Chinese market that will drive business transformation to improve productivity.

«With much uncertainty still ahead, we are very proud to support the digitalization initiatives of our customers in China. We are committed to being the best partner for our customers,» said Edward Wang, Vice President and General Manager of APAC for Gerber Technology. «Through our recent Shanghai Innovation Center expansion initiative and the launch of the Gerber Atria™ Digital Cutter, we are proud to offer our customers the best experience and innovations to help them achieve greater productivity and accelerate digital transformation initiatives.»

Gerber’s Shanghai Innovation Center demonstrates the latest innovations for both mass production and on-demand manufacturing, demonstrating how companies can digitally transform their supply chain and achieve best in class performance. The recently upgraded innovative space features a full made-to-measure workflow that turns orders into final products in less than one hour. The workflow is complete with TG3D’s body scanning technology, the powerful AccuMark® Made-to-Measure, AccuMark, and AccuNest™ software and Gerber’s vision-based single ply cutters.

At its annual ideation conference in November, Gerber launched the Gerber Atria Digital Cutter, which provides significant throughput uplift and excellent cutting quality. Since its release less than 60 days ago, 17 different companies have decided that Atria is the solution they need on their digital transformation journey.

JUNO BEACH, Fla., Jan. 26, 2021 /PRNewswire/ — First Student, Inc., First Transit, Inc., and NextEra Energy Resources, LLC today announced they have entered into a framework agreement and are working toward a joint venture to pursue the electrification of tens of thousands of school and public transportation vehicles across the U.S. and Canada. The collaboration brings together North America’s market leaders in school and public transportation and renewable energy to foster innovation and accelerate the mass adoption of zero-emission vehicles. 

The transition to electric vehicles for the school and public transportation sector is expected to play a critical role in helping communities improve air quality and environmental health for student passengers, transit riders and area residents. In addition, utilizing the sizeable batteries of school and public transportation electric vehicle fleets for distributed energy storage and grid services has the potential to make a significant contribution to long-term sustainable clean energy transition in North America.

Student transportation market

The U.S. and Canada combined represent the largest homogeneous student transportation market in the world, with approximately 520,000 yellow school buses in total. This market has remained consistent in size over time, with certain favorable factors driving fleet conversion to electric vehicles and potential V2G development:

–  Increasing demand for clean, pollution-free school buses from schools, communities, parents, and student passengers.
–  Strategic location of school bus depots for installation of necessary charging, storage and grid connection infrastructure.
–  Low utilization and predictable daily schedules of school buses, providing greater opportunity to optimize power charging and balance the grid.

The companies are collaborating to address these market opportunities by first capitalizing on First Student’s fleet of 43,000 yellow school buses, the single largest fleet in North America, and nearly 500 depots located across 40 U.S. states and seven Canadian provinces. Combining this scale with NextEra Energy Resources’ expertise is anticipated to help accelerate electrification from individual pilots to broader fleet rollout across the U.S. and Canada.

Transit market

The U.S. and Canada combined represent one of the world’s largest public transit markets, with approximately 160,000 buses and other vehicles in total. In addition, there are significant fleet opportunities in shuttle services that address a variety of passenger transportation needs.

These markets have demonstrated long-term stability servicing a range of clients such as municipal transit authorities, airports and universities. The transit market is equally anticipating a shift to electric vehicles, driven by an increased emphasis on delivering clean, pollution-free transit solutions.

The collaboration intends to focus on First Transit’s base of more than 300 customers to create new business opportunities and revenue streams associated with fleet electrification.

SAN FRANCISCO, Jan. 26, 2021 /PRNewswire/ — AllTrails, the most trusted and used digital guide to the outdoors announced a substantial milestone – surpassing 1 million paid subscribers for its premium service, AllTrails Pro. Home to the largest collection of hand-curated trail guides, the outdoor recreation website and app also maintains a global community of over 25 million registered users.

Even prior to the pandemic, the outdoor sector was experiencing rapid year-over-year growth as more people turned to nature for mental and physical health. By May 2020, when pandemic lockdowns loosened, AllTrails saw an accelerated surge of usage as people reconnected with the outdoors. The company saw record-breaking growth continue through December, a contrast to the seasonal growth that is typical in the outdoor industry. While habit changes during the pandemic further accelerated business performance, the behavior also underscores the impact nature has on mental and physical health. 

«At AllTrails, we believe that everyone has a right to the outdoors, regardless of age, gender, ethnicity, or socioeconomic standing,» said Ron Schneidermann, CEO of AllTrails. «Our public lands are for everyone to enjoy and to experience the mental, physical, and emotional health benefits that come from spending time outside. This level of growth confirms that we are on the right path in leveraging technology to democratize access to the outdoors for all.»

To commemorate the milestone, AllTrails, a 1% For The Planet member, is partnering with One Tree Planted to plant 10 thousand trees – one thousand trees for each year AllTrails has served its global community of outdoor enthusiasts.

«AllTrails’ breakout growth is representative of a larger trend of people adopting new lifestyles and looking to the outdoors,» said Ben Spero, managing director at Spectrum Equity, a growth equity firm that is AllTrails’ majority shareholder. «It’s a rare accomplishment for a consumer subscription service to reach 1 million paid subscribers, and this milestone is a testament to the unique service AllTrails provides its community in helping connect them to the outdoors and to nature,» he added.

In the past year, AllTrails has achieved:

  • One million AllTrails Pro subscribers
  • Over 25 million cumulative registered users
  • Nearly 130% year-over-year increase in daily active users
  • Publishing of nearly 200 thousand trail guides
  • Trail coverage in 190 countries, 30 territories, and all 7 continents
